Finding a wedding planner: our tips

Your wedding day is a once-in-a-lifetime moment, a time when all your dreams of love and happiness come true. However, planning a wedding can be a monumental task, fraught with logistical challenges, emotions and important decisions. That’s where a wedding planner comes in. Hiring a professional to guide you through the planning process can make all the difference between a stressful wedding and an unforgettable one.

In this article, we’ll explore the essential steps to finding the perfect wedding planner who can turn your aspirations into reality and help you have the wedding of your dreams.

Do your research:

The first step to finding the perfect wedding planner is to carry out thorough research. Explore the different options available by asking friends and family for recommendations, browsing specialist websites, wedding forums and social networks to read reviews and testimonials from previous clients. An experienced wedding planner has a solid reputation and many positive references from previous weddings. Take the time to research and draw up a list of the professionals that catch your eye.

Define your budget:

Before you start contacting wedding planners, it’s essential to establish a clear and realistic budget for your wedding. A good wedding planner can help you maximise your budget while creating a beautiful wedding. Define your priorities and the aspects you want to delegate, whether it’s decorating, coordinating the big day, or managing all the details from start to finish. With a clear idea of your budget, you’ll be able to choose a wedding planner who meets your financial needs.

Check their references and experience:

Once you’ve shortlisted a few potential wedding planners, take the time to check their references and experience. Ask them how many weddings they have organised and whether any of them were similar to what you are planning. Don’t hesitate to ask them for photos or testimonials of previous weddings to assess their style and expertise. An experienced wedding planner will be able to adapt to your wishes while providing creative ideas to make your wedding unique and memorable.

Meet them in person:

The chemistry between you and your wedding planner is an essential element of a successful collaboration. Set up face-to-face meetings with your potential candidates. This is an opportunity to discuss your vision for the wedding, ask questions about their approach and see if you get on well. A good wedding planner should listen to your needs, be patient in answering your questions, and be able to capture the essence of your wishes. An emotional and professional connection between you and your wedding planner is essential to make the planning process smooth and enjoyable.

Check their portfolio:

A wedding planner’s portfolio is like their business card. Ask potential candidates to show you examples of their previous work. Look at their past work to see if their style matches your taste and vision for your wedding. Every wedding planner has their own aesthetic and way of managing events, so make sure their approach fits with what you’re looking for.

Talk about your vision:

When interviewing potential wedding planners, be clear and specific about your vision for the wedding. Tell them your ideas, your favourite themes, your colours, and share your emotions and hopes for your big day. A good wedding planner will take your preferences into account and incorporate them into the planning details. Open and honest communication is essential to ensure that your wedding truly reflects who you are as a couple.

Ask for additional recommendations:

If a wedding planner you’ve met isn’t available or doesn’t meet your needs, don’t hesitate to ask if they can recommend other professionals in the sector. Wedding planners often know other colleagues and can refer you to someone who will better meet your expectations. Don’t overlook recommendations, as they can be a valuable source for uncovering hidden talent.

Read the contract carefully:

Before signing a contract with a wedding planner, make sure you read all the details of the contract carefully, including rates, services included, payment terms, and deadlines. Ask questions about anything you don’t understand and make sure you agree with the terms before committing yourself. A clear, well-defined contract will avoid any misunderstandings and ensure a smooth collaboration with your wedding planner.

Follow your instincts:

Above all, listen to your instincts when choosing your wedding planner. Your intuition can guide you towards the person who will understand you best and who will be able to transform your wedding into a magical moment. If you feel a positive connection with a particular professional and feel comfortable entrusting them with the planning of your wedding, it’s probably the right choice.
Finding the perfect wedding planner is not a task to be taken lightly, as this person will play a vital role in creating your dream wedding. By doing thorough research, clearly defining your budget, checking the references and experience of potential candidates, meeting wedding planners in person, carefully examining their portfolio, openly communicating your vision, asking for additional recommendations, carefully reading the contract, and following your instincts, you will be well prepared to choose the wedding planner who will turn your aspirations into reality…
